#d7d0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7d0ce is composed of 84.3% red, 81.6%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.3% magenta, 4.2%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 13.3 degrees, a saturation of 10.1% and a lightness of 82.5%. #d7d0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#afa19d.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#d7d0ce color description : Grayish red.
#d7d0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d7d0ce has RGB values of R:215, G:208,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.04,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14143694.
